网站开发支付模块的核心在于构建安全、稳定且高转化的交易闭环,而非简单的接口对接。 一个优秀的支付模块必须将资金安全置于首位,同时兼顾用户体验与系统扩展性,在当前的互联网环境下,支付模块不仅是资金流转的通道,更是用户信任的基石,若支付环节出现延迟、掉单或安全漏洞,将直接导致用户流失和品牌信誉崩塌,构建支付模块需遵循“安全架构先行、用户体验优化、数据全链路监控”的金字塔原则,通过分层设计实现业务与技术的完美融合。

安全架构:构建金融级的防御体系
支付安全是模块的生命线,任何功能创新都必须建立在绝对安全的基础之上。多重加密机制是防御数据泄露的第一道防线,必须采用国密算法或国际标准的 AES-256对敏感信息进行加密存储,确保即便数据库被拖库,攻击者也无法获取明文信息。数字签名与验签机制不可或缺,所有支付请求必须携带由商户私钥生成的签名,服务端使用公钥验签,彻底杜绝请求篡改和重放攻击。
防重放攻击与防暴力破解策略需嵌入网关层,通过引入时间戳校验和随机数(Nonce)机制,确保每个请求的唯一性;针对登录和支付接口,实施动态验证码与频率限制策略,有效拦截恶意扫描,在架构层面,建议采用前后端分离与微服务隔离,将支付核心逻辑部署在独立的内网区域,仅通过受控的 API 网关暴露必要接口,最大限度减少攻击面。
用户体验:从“能支付”到“愿支付”
支付转化率是衡量模块成功与否的关键指标,用户往往因为流程繁琐或加载缓慢而放弃支付。秒级响应是提升体验的核心,这要求支付网关具备高并发处理能力与低延迟架构,通过引入异步回调机制,前端无需等待后端完成所有银行侧的复杂校验,即可立即反馈“处理中”状态,消除用户等待焦虑。
多渠道适配也是提升体验的关键,现代用户习惯多样,支付模块必须无缝集成微信支付、支付宝、银联云闪付以及数字人民币等主流渠道,并支持H5、小程序、APP 及 PC 端的自适应跳转,针对海外业务,还需集成 Stripe、PayPal 等跨境支付方案,并自动匹配最优路由,确保全球用户都能获得流畅的支付体验。
独家经验案例:酷番云高并发支付实战
在某电商大促活动中,客户面临流量激增导致支付接口超时的痛点,酷番云团队介入后,并未单纯增加服务器带宽,而是利用酷番云弹性计算资源构建了动态扩容的支付集群,通过酷番云智能负载均衡技术,将支付请求智能分发至不同地域的节点,结合酷番云分布式缓存预热热点数据,成功将支付接口响应时间从 2.5 秒降低至 0.3 秒,利用酷番云的全链路监控体系,实时捕捉并自动熔断异常节点,确保了在大促期间零掉单、零故障,最终助力客户实现支付转化率提升 15%,这一案例证明,云原生架构与智能调度是解决高并发支付难题的必由之路。
数据监控与风控:全生命周期的闭环管理
支付模块的价值不仅在于交易完成,更在于数据的可追溯性与风险的可控性,必须建立全链路日志审计系统,从用户发起请求、网关转发、银行交互到最终回调,每一个环节都必须记录详细的Trace ID,确保在出现纠纷时能秒级定位问题。
智能风控系统应作为支付模块的“大脑”实时运行,通过机器学习算法分析用户行为特征(如 IP 地址突变、设备指纹异常、交易频率异常等),对高风险交易进行实时拦截或二次验证,建立对账自动化机制,每日定时自动拉取银行流水与本地订单进行比对,发现差异立即触发告警,确保资金账实相符。
合规性与扩展性:面向未来的基石
随着法律法规的日益严格,支付模块必须严格遵循PCI-DSS(支付卡行业数据安全标准)及个人信息保护法要求。数据脱敏处理是合规的底线,所有展示在日志或前端的卡号、身份证信息必须经过掩码处理。
在扩展性方面,采用插件化架构设计,将不同支付渠道封装为标准接口,当需要接入新渠道时,无需重构核心代码,仅需开发对应插件即可上线,这种设计模式极大地降低了后续维护成本,使系统能够灵活应对市场变化。
相关问答模块
Q1:支付模块出现掉单(用户已扣款但订单未更新)该如何处理?
A: 掉单通常由网络超时或回调失败引起,系统应启用主动查询机制,在回调超时后,定时向支付渠道发起订单状态查询;建立幂等性处理逻辑,确保同一笔订单的回调指令只被执行一次;结合酷番云分布式消息队列,将异步回调任务削峰填谷,确保消息不丢失、不重复,从根本上解决掉单问题。

Q2:如何保障支付接口在遭受 DDoS 攻击时的稳定性?
A: 防御 DDoS 攻击需采用“云端清洗 + 本地防护”的双重策略,接入酷番云高防 IP或 CDN 服务,在流量进入源站前完成恶意流量的清洗与过滤;在应用层实施WAF(Web 应用防火墙) 策略,针对高频请求进行限流;配置自动熔断降级机制,当系统负载超过阈值时,自动切换至静态维护页或仅保留核心支付功能,保障业务连续性。
互动话题
您在开发支付模块时,遇到过最棘手的“坑”是什么?是并发导致的超卖,还是复杂的对账问题?欢迎在评论区分享您的实战经验,我们将挑选优质评论赠送酷番云云产品体验券一份!
图片来源于AI模型,如侵权请联系管理员。作者:酷小编,如若转载,请注明出处:https://www.kufanyun.com/ask/433224.html


评论列表(3条)
这篇文章的内容非常有价值,我从中学习到了很多新的知识和观点。作者的写作风格简洁明了,却又不失深度,让人读起来很舒服。特别是网站开发支付模块的核心在于构建安全部分,
这篇文章的内容非常有价值,我从中学习到了很多新的知识和观点。作者的写作风格简洁明了,却又不失深度,让人读起来很舒服。特别是网站开发支付模块的核心在于构建安全部分,
这篇文章的内容非常有价值,我从中学习到了很多新的知识和观点。作者的写作风格简洁明了,却又不失深度,让人读起来很舒服。特别是网站开发支付模块的核心在于构建安全部分,